๐Ÿ“– Spider Solitaire Rules โ€” The Complete Indian Reference

Understanding the rules is the first step to mastery. Here's everything you need, explained in desi terms.

Setup & Objective

  • Decks: 2 standard decks (104 cards total).
  • Tableau: 10 columns โ€” first 4 columns have 6 cards each, last 6 columns have 5 cards each. Only the top card of each column is face-up.
  • Stock: Remaining 50 cards are dealt 10 at a time (5 deals of 10).
  • Goal: Build 8 complete sequences (King to Ace, same suit). Each completed sequence is removed from the tableau.

Movement Rules

  • You can move any face-up card (or sequence) to another column if the top card is one rank higher (e.g., 7 on 8).
  • Key constraint: Only sequences of the same suit can be moved as a group. Mixed-suit sequences cannot be moved.
  • When a column is empty, you can start a new sequence with any available card.
  • Use the stock (bottom-right) to deal 10 new cards โ€” one to each column โ€” when you're stuck.

Common Mistakes Indian Players Make

  • โŒ Playing too fast: Spider is a marathon, not a sprint. Average winning time for 4-suit is 18 minutes.
  • โŒ Ignoring empty columns: An empty column is a golden asset โ€” use it to reorganise suits.
  • โŒ Mixing suits prematurely: Once suits are mixed, you can't move them as a block. Plan ahead!
  • โŒ Not using undo: Most digital versions have unlimited undo โ€” use it to explore branches.
